
A dual port modular socket is a space-saving connectivity solution that integrates two independent ports into a single housing, allowing two separate wired connections to be established simultaneously—making it ideal for environments where multiple devices need to be connected in a compact space. Similar to single port sockets, dual port models are available in shielded and unshielded variants, with most featuring standard RJ45 interfaces for Ethernet, though some combinations (e.g., one RJ45 port and two USB ports) are also available to support mixed connectivity needs. The dual port design conserves valuable PCB space and reduces the number of components required in device designs, making it a popular choice for network hubs, switches, audio-visual equipment, gaming consoles, and wall plates in offices, homes, and data centers where space efficiency is a priority.
Dual port modular sockets are engineered to maintain high performance while supporting two concurrent connections, with features such as optimized contact spacing to minimize crosstalk between the two ports, integrated shielding (in shielded models) for EMI/RFI protection, and LED indicators for each port to show connection status. They support high-speed data transmission up to 10GBASE-T when designed for Category 6A or higher cables, making them suitable for gigabit Ethernet networks in both commercial and industrial settings. The sockets are typically mounted via through-hole or surface-mount technology, with right-angle or vertical orientation options to accommodate different installation requirements, and they comply with standards such as RoHS, IEEE 802.3, and ANSI/TIA-568, ensuring compatibility with a wide range of network devices and cables.
Common applications of dual port modular sockets include office workstations (where a computer and IP phone need to be connected), data center racks (for connecting multiple servers or switches), home entertainment systems (linking gaming consoles and smart TVs), and industrial control panels (connecting sensors and monitoring devices). Shielded dual port models are particularly useful in industrial or high-interference environments, where they provide the same EMI/RFI protection as single port shielded sockets while doubling the number of connections. With their space-saving design, dual functionality, and reliable performance, dual port modular sockets offer an efficient solution for scenarios where multiple wired connections are needed without sacrificing space or signal quality.
